EDITORS COMMENTS
This portrait of Martin Van Buren, the eighth President of the United States (1837-1841), was painted by renowned American artist George Peter Alexander Healy in 1864. Van Buren, born on December 5, 1782, was a prominent figure in the Democratic Party and a key architect of the Second Party System. His presidency was marked by the Panic of 1837, an economic crisis that led to widespread suffering and hardship. In this portrait, Van Buren is depicted as a mature, thoughtful man, dressed in a formal suit and wearing a starched shirt. His right hand rests on a stack of documents, symbolizing his duties as President and his commitment to public service. The background is simple, with a plain, dark curtain as the only adornment, drawing the viewer's focus to Van Buren's face and demeanor. Healy's use of light and shadow creates a sense of depth and texture, bringing the portrait to life. The painting is now housed in the National Portrait Gallery in Washington D.C., a fitting home for this important piece of American history. Van Buren's presidency may be a chapter in the past, but his legacy continues to shape the political landscape of the United States.
